About Wengong Wang
Wengong Wang is a scholar working on Molecular Biology, Cancer Research, Physiology, Electrical and Electronic Engineering and Oncology, having authored 64 papers that have together received 4.9k indexed citations. Recurring topics across this work include RNA modifications and cancer (31 papers), RNA Research and Splicing (21 papers), Cancer-related molecular mechanisms research (10 papers), MicroRNA in disease regulation (9 papers), Cancer-related gene regulation (7 papers), Organic Electronics and Photovoltaics (5 papers), Conducting polymers and applications (5 papers) and Perovskite Materials and Applications (5 papers). The work is most often cited by research in Cancer Research (1.4k citations), Molecular Biology (3.8k citations), Aging (68 citations), Geriatrics and Gerontology (62 citations) and Oncology (461 citations). Wengong Wang has collaborated with scholars based in China, United States and United Kingdom. Frequent co-authors include Myriam Gorospe, Xiaoling Yang, Hao Tang, Henry Furneaux, M.Craig Caldwell, Nikki J. Holbrook, Shankung Lin, Tanjun Tong, Jie Yi and Isabel López de Silanes. Their work appears in journals such as Molecular and Cellular Biology, Journal of Biological Chemistry, Journal of Cellular Biochemistry, Oncotarget and Nucleic Acids Research.
